The mosquito situation in Tatalon, Philippines can be a cause for concern. Due to the tropical climate and abundance of stagnant water sources, mosquitoes thrive in this area. Mosquitoes are known carriers of various diseases such as dengue fever, malaria, and Zika virus, posing a significant health risk to the residents of Tatalon. The local government and health authorities have implemented several measures to control the mosquito population and prevent the spread of diseases.
To combat the mosquito situation in Tatalon, various initiatives have been undertaken. These include regular fogging and spraying of insecticides in high-risk areas, such as near water bodies and densely populated areas. Additionally, public awareness campaigns are conducted to educate residents about the importance of eliminating mosquito breeding sites, such as stagnant water in containers and discarded tires. Efforts are also made to improve sanitation and drainage systems to reduce the availability of breeding grounds for mosquitoes.
